The working principle of an Atmospheric Water Generator (AWG) involves a series of steps in the water production process:

1. Air Collection: The AWG draws in surrounding air, which contains moisture in the form of water vapor.

2. Air Purification: The collected air goes through a purification process to remove impurities, dust, and contaminants, ensuring the water’s cleanliness.

3. Condensation: Next, the purified air is cooled to the point where the water vapor in the air condenses into liquid water droplets. This is typically achieved using a refrigeration or cooling system.

4. Water Purification: The condensed water is then further purified to remove any remaining impurities, minerals, or potential contaminants.

5. UV Sterilization: As a final step, ultraviolet (UV) sterilization is often employed to ensure the water is free from harmful microorganisms and pathogens, making it safe for consumption.

By following these steps, an Atmospheric Water Generator is capable of producing clean and safe drinking water from the moisture present in the surrounding air.”

Not really, the machine is affected by the ambient temperature and humidity. The machine can produce water at temperatures between 15~38℃ and humidity between 35~90%. If this operating condition is not met, the machine’s compressor will shut down to save energy.

The Solaris Water Generator consumes 230W of energy daily, producing up to 10 liters of water at a cost of approximately 16 cents per day. Over a month (30 days), this totals $4.80 for 300 liters of pure water, which equates to just $0.016 per liter. 

(This calculation might change based of your location and current energy cost)

✅ Best Cleaning Solution for Stainless Steel Tanks in AWGs

 

🧴 Recommended Cleaning Agent:

Food-grade citric acid or white vinegar (5% acetic acid) is ideal. These are:

 

Non-toxic

Safe for water systems

Effective at removing limescale, biofilm, and minor corrosion

🧼 Cleaning Protocol (Manual or Maintenance Routine)

 

🔧 Materials Needed:

Food-grade citric acid powder or white vinegar

Soft sponge or microfiber cloth (non-abrasive)

Clean water

Optional: UV-safe disinfectant spray (e.g., hypochlorous acid solution or food-safe hydrogen peroxide <3%)

🧪 Step-by-Step Process (Monthly or as needed)

Option 1: Citric Acid Method

 

Prepare Solution:

Mix 1 tablespoon (15g) of citric acid per 1 liter of warm water.

Pour into Tank:

Fill the tank and let it sit for 20–30 minutes.

Scrub Lightly:

Use a soft sponge to clean internal surfaces if accessible.

Rinse Thoroughly:

Empty and rinse with clean water 2–3 times.

Option 2: White Vinegar

 

Fill the tank with a mix of 1:1 water and vinegar.

Let sit for 30 minutes.

Rinse thoroughly 2–3 times to eliminate the smell/taste.

🦠 Disinfection Step (Optional, After Cleaning)

Use a UV-safe, food-grade sanitizer like:

 

Hypochlorous acid (200 ppm)

Hydrogen peroxide (3% max)

Spray interior, let sit for 5 minutes, and rinse once with clean water.

 

❌ Avoid:

 

Bleach (can corrode stainless steel and leave toxic residues)

Abrasive brushes or metal scouring pads

Harsh industrial descalers not labeled food-safe

🔁 Recommended Cleaning Frequency

 

Residential Users: Every 3–4 weeks

Commercial Use (hotel, office, etc.): Every 2–3 weeks

If water has a taste or odor issue: Clean immediately
